ANLA Elects New Board LeadersSource: American Nursery & Landscape Association

During their annual meeting in Columbus, Ohio this year, the American Nursery & Landscape Association (ANLA) held elections for their new leaders. This year’s board of directors will see a new president-elect as well as two new members filling their seats. ANLA’s Division Boards will also welcome new members.

The following are the new positions of the elected members:

  • President-Elect: Tom Courtright, Orchard Nursery & Florist (Calif.)
  • Board of Directors: John Bryant, Millican Nurseries (N.H.)
  • Board of Directors: Stan Brown, Alameda Wholesale Nursery (Colo.)
  • Landscape Distribution Division Board: Matt Sawyer, Bennett’s Creek Wholesale Nursery (Va.)
  • Grower Division Board: Steve Hutton, The Conard-Pyle Co. (Pa.)
  • Grower Division Board: Peter Scarff, Scarff’s Nursery (Ohio)
  • Landscape Division Board: Scott Price, Snow’s (Va.)
  • Landscape Division Board: Kyle Natorp, Natorp’s (Ohio)
